Features

  1. One Click Install: Minimal setup required.
  2. Secure Credit Card Processing: Collect.js tokenization for PCI-DSS compliance.
  3. Authorize Now, Capture Later: Authorize transactions and capture at a later date.
  4. Refund via Dashboard: Full or partial refunds are available from your Magento dashboard.
  5. Gateway Receipts: Send receipts from your merchant account.
  6. Logging: Debug issues with logging enabled.
  7. 3D Secure 2 Card Verification: Optional for Strong Customer Authentication (SCA) compliance.

Requirements

  • SSL certificate for secure payment transmission
  • Magento 2.4.5+ powered website
